To be a shareholder in OPENLANE, you need to believe the company can maintain its lead as digital adoption accelerates in the wholesale vehicle auction industry, driving further revenue and profit growth. The recent earnings guidance upgrade is a positive short-term catalyst, signaling improved operational momentum, but it doesn’t eliminate the main challenge: stronger competition from rivals expanding digital platforms, which could impact margins and limit gains if competitive pressures intensify.
The sharp upward revision to full-year 2025 earnings guidance, announced with the latest results, is the most relevant recent development. This substantial increase in expected income and earnings per share highlights management’s growing confidence in profitability, aligning with the company’s ongoing investments in automation and digital tools, which remain central to sustaining OPENLANE’s market share and supporting the current growth outlook.

OPENLANE's narrative projects $2.0 billion revenue and $203.0 million earnings by 2028. This requires 1.9% yearly revenue growth and a $112.7 million earnings increase from $90.3 million today.
Uncover how OPENLANE's forecasts yield a $26.17 fair value, a 9% downside to its current price.
